From the UMD beat writer's blog in the Duluth News Tribune:
"...from Brad Elliott Schlossman of the Grand Forks Herald: Ralph
Engelstad Arena general manager Jody Hodgson says that if he gets his
wish, the arena will not be changing anything, despite the State
Board of Higher Education's ruling that North Dakota change its
nickname and logo. Engelstad Arena is not part of the settlement with
the NCAA and it is privately owned. The NCAA may not grant Englestad
a regional if the logos stay, although Hodgson says he doesn't really
care."
